9 For to this end I also wrote, that I might know the proof of you, whether you are obedient in all things.

Ranked cross references
Connections are ranked by community votes in the OpenBible.info cross-reference dataset (CC BY 4.0). They suggest related themes, words, events, or people; they are not automatic interpretations.
2 Corinthians 10:6
and being in readiness to avenge all disobedience when your obedience is made full.
5 relevance votesPhilemon 1:21
Having confidence in your obedience, I write to you, knowing that you will do even beyond what I say.
4 relevance votesPhilippians 2:22
But you know that he has proved himself. As a child serves a father, so he served with me in furtherance of the Good News.
3 relevance votesDeuteronomy 8:2
You shall remember all the way which the LORD your God has led you these forty years in the wilderness, that he might humble you, to test you, to know what was in your heart, whether you would keep his commandments or not.
2 relevance votesDeuteronomy 8:16
who fed you in the wilderness with manna, which your fathers didn’t know, that he might humble you, and that he might prove you, to do you good at your latter end;
2 relevance votesExodus 16:4
Then the LORD said to Moses, “Behold, I will rain bread from the sky for you, and the people shall go out and gather a day’s portion every day, that I may test them, whether they will walk in my law or not.
2 relevance votes2 Corinthians 8:24
Therefore show the proof of your love to them before the assemblies, and of our boasting on your behalf.
2 relevance votes2 Thessalonians 3:14
If any man doesn’t obey our word in this letter, note that man and have no company with him, to the end that he may be ashamed.
2 relevance votesPhilippians 2:12
So then, my beloved, even as you have always obeyed, not only in my presence, but now much more in my absence, work out your own salvation with fear and trembling.
2 relevance votesDeuteronomy 13:3
you shall not listen to the words of that prophet, or to that dreamer of dreams; for the LORD your God is testing you, to know whether you love the LORD your God with all your heart and with all your soul.
